Gas reserves have been discovered first time from Mari East Field in Rahim Yar Khan


Karachi: Oil and Gas Development Company Limited (OGDCL) has claimed that new oil and gas reserves have been discovered in Sindh and Punjab provinces.
OGDCL has sent details of the oil and gas reserves discovered to the Pakistan Stock Exchange (PSX).
The letter written by the company said that multi-physiochemical stimulation technology was used for the first time in Pisakhi Oilfield VII in Hyderabad. With modern technology in Pisakhi Oilfield, crude oil production has increased from 375 barrels per day to 520 barrels, and crude oil production has increased by 145 barrels per day.
OGDCL said in the letter that gas reserves have been discovered for the first time from Mari East Field in Rahim Yar Khan. Two MMSCFD gas is transferred to Engro Fertilizer through a 14.5-kilometer pipeline.
